This Hungarian indie quartet, named after the character from Lev Tolstoy’s works, will be performing at the Klebelsberg Kultúrkúria in Budapest, specifically at 1028 Budapest, Templom u. 2-10.
Formed in 2016, Platon Karataev explores the very essence of existence through their music, traversing paradoxes and seeking answers. Their music oscillates from atomic observations to celestial perspectives, weaving a tapestry of thought-provoking melodies and lyrics.

After gaining instant success with their acoustic-infused album “For Her’s” in 2017, the band took a progressive turn with their more instrumentally complex album “Atoms” in 2020. With a focus on speaking in the most universal yet deeply personal way possible, “Atoms” encompasses elements of catharsis. Platon Karataev’s newest album, “Partért kiáltó,” delves even deeper into the collective subconscious, taking listeners on a voyage of introspection and discovery.
Platon Karataev has garnered attention not just locally, but also on an international scale over the past four years. With over 5 million streams on Spotify, their music has reached audiences primarily in the United States, United Kingdom, and Germany. The band has also had the privilege of performing at renowned festivals such as Sziget, Reeperbahn, Zandari Festa Seoul, Moscow Music Week, and Liverpool Sound City, in addition to three successful tours in Germany.

Join us for an outdoor movie screening of the Hungarian animated film “Macskafogó” at mozi.kert, located in the MOMkult garden. This iconic film, directed by Béla Ternovszky, was released in 1986 and has since become a cult classic. It is a must-watch for anyone interested in Hungarian pop culture.
“Macskafogó” tells the story of three brave children who fight against a gang of cats who are trying to take over the world. The film is known for its memorable lines and imaginative animation, making it a beloved part of Hungarian everyday life. Insane Hellride Entertainment, in collaboration with Killtown Bookings and Dürer Kert, presents the “Manifested Apparitions of Ungodly Death Tour 2023,” featuring the legendary American band DETERIOROT. This will be their first ever performance in Hungary. Formed in 1990, DETERIOROT is considered a true veteran in the death metal scene, particularly in the USA. Known for their ferocious sound, this New Jersey death metal unit released their first demos in the early 90s, followed by full-length albums in 2001 and 2010. In July, alongside their European tour, they will release their much-awaited comeback LP, “The Rebirth,” picking up where they left off 13 years ago.
Joining them on this brutal tour is ASCENDED DEAD, representing the more gruesome and obscure side of the American death metal scene. Hailing from San Diego, this band will reach deep into your soul with their filthy music. The local support for the event will come from the recently reformed CRYPTIC REMAINS, hailing from Budapest. This band skillfully blends technical riffs with sheer decay, delivering a powerful performance.

The Magyar Zene Háza is hosting an outdoor film screening of the Hungarian movie “Csinibaba” (1996) on Wednesday, August 23, 2023, from 8:00 PM to 9:30 PM UTC+02. This retro film by director Tímár Péter takes us back to the early 1960s, showcasing relics of the consolidating socialism era such as the Pacsirta radio, grízes tészta (semolina pasta), Bambi soft drinks, and household tube radios. It depicts a time when the talent show “Ki mit tud?” (What Can You Do?) was a major event that mobilized the masses, with the winners earning a trip to Helsinki beyond the Iron Curtain. As you immerse yourself in the movie, you’ll also be treated to iconic songs from that era, performed by artists from the 1990s.
